> > i am running sarge on an g3 newworld powerbook
> 
> Which model?  There are two NewWorld PowerBooks with G3 processors,
> the Lombard and the Pismo.  You can easily recognise them, the Lombard
> has a SCSI port at the rear while the Pismo has two Firewire ports.
> 
> > and with a standard debian 2.4.26-powerpc-pmac kernel almost
> > everything is fine. but when i want to upgrade to a 2.6.7-powerpc
> > kernel, my network is not recognised anymore :
> [...]
> > the same happens with the 2.4.26-powerpc-small-pmac kernel.
> [...]
> > following the discussion on this list i installed discover1, but it
> > did not help ...
> 
> From the symptoms, I would assume that you have a Lombard and need to
> load the bmac driver manually (the Pismo has a gmac ethernet card, and
> it's sungem driver is found nicely by discover).  Try and run the
> command 'modprobe bmac' while running the 2.6.7 kernel, and if that
> works add a line containing just 'bmac' to the file /etc/modules.
